Summary

This study tests whether a non-invasive brain stimulation technique called theta burst stimulation (TBS) can improve core symptoms of autism, such as social difficulties and repetitive behaviors. Researchers will apply TBS to a specific brain area (right inferior frontal gyrus) in 60 participants aged 8 to 30 with autism. The study measures changes in social responsiveness, repetitive behaviors, and emotional regulation using questionnaires and brain scans.

What this could lead to
If it works, this could point toward a non-drug treatment to help reduce core autism symptoms like social difficulties and repetitive behaviors.
What could go wrong
This is an early, small study (60 people) testing a new brain stimulation target. It may not produce clear benefits, and effects could vary widely between individuals.
